### Bug Description

On start of `/speckit.tasks` in PowerShell environment, it attempts to call function
`Test-FeatureJsonMatchesFeatureDir`
An error is thrown and there is no such commandlet.

CoPilot eventually worked around the problem.

```shell
.\.specify\scripts\powershell\setup-tasks.ps1 -Json
C:\Code\private\app\.specify\scripts\powershell\setup-tasks.ps1 : The term
'Test-FeatureJsonMatchesFeatureDir' is not recognized as the name of a cmdlet, function, script file, or
operable program. Check the spelling of the name, or if a path was included, verify that the path is
correct and try again.
At line:1 char:1
+ .\.specify\scripts\powershell\setup-tasks.ps1 -Json
+ 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
+ CategoryInfo : ObjectNotFound: (Test-FeatureJsonMatchesFeatureDir:String) [setup-tasks.ps1]
, CommandNotFoundException
+ FullyQualifiedErrorId : CommandNotFoundException,setup-tasks.ps1
```

### Steps to Reproduce

1: Run `/speckit.tasks`
2: Errors noted for missing function `Test-FeatureJsonMatchesFeatureDir`

The function checks if feature.json pins an existing feature directory, and if it does, branch naming validation gets skipped.

Since the function is missing from common.ps1, this validation logic can't run.

### Error Logs

```shell
.\.specify\scripts\powershell\setup-tasks.ps1 -Json
C:\Code\private\app\.specify\scripts\powershell\setup-tasks.ps1 : At
C:\Code\private\app\.specify\scripts\powershell\common.ps1:141 char:122
+ ... -Path $RepoRoot $pinnedRelative) -ErrorAction SilentlyContinue)?.Path
+ ~~~~~~
Unexpected token '?.Path' in expression or statement.
At C:\Code\private\app\.specify\scripts\powershell\common.ps1:142 char:102
+ ... h -LiteralPath $ActiveFeatureDir -ErrorAction SilentlyContinue)?.Path
+ ~~~~~~
Unexpected token '?.Path' in expression or statement.
At line:1 char:1
+ .\.specify\scripts\powershell\setup-tasks.ps1 -Json
+ 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
+ CategoryInfo : ParserError: (:) [setup-tasks.ps1], ParseException
+ FullyQualifiedErrorId : UnexpectedToken,setup-tasks.ps1
```
